Transaction 3c0816d51a6c11cb29215321b07cefe772a159c32994dcd92470f50be31c63ea

1 Input
2 Outputs
  • 3c0816d51a6c11cb29215321b07cefe772a159c32994dcd92470f50be31c63ea:0
  • value  17300
    address  1AFfD332TnJWx2qU4nhkRQZ8Tui3pdaDzS
  • 3c0816d51a6c11cb29215321b07cefe772a159c32994dcd92470f50be31c63ea:1
  • value  1081918
    address  3Bb9SoFzndkkLmNAXboDUT1UPFVRbYc3td